Mahomes Overcomes Ankle Sprain to Secure Chiefs’ Victory Over Texans

Patrick Mahomes’ Resilience Shines Through Ankle Injury in Victory Over Texans

Patrick Mahomes, the star quarterback of the Kansas City Chiefs, once again demonstrated his remarkable resilience and ability to overcome adversity, leading his team to a 27-19 victory over the Houston Texans despite battling an ankle sprain. Mahomes’ performance, which included 260 passing yards, one touchdown pass, and one touchdown run, underscored his unwavering determination and commitment to his team’s success. The victory not only extended the Chiefs’ impressive winning streak but also brought them closer to securing the coveted No. 1 seed in the AFC, a significant advantage in their pursuit of a historic third consecutive Super Bowl title.

Mahomes’ ability to play, and play effectively, was far from certain after he sustained the ankle injury during the previous week’s game against the Cleveland Browns. The injury, which typically requires a recovery period of two to four weeks, raised concerns about his availability for the Texans game. However, Mahomes defied expectations by participating fully in practice throughout the week, demonstrating his exceptional mental toughness and physical recovery capabilities. This commitment to his team, even in the face of injury, has become a hallmark of Mahomes’ leadership and has earned him the admiration of his coaches and teammates.

The Chiefs’ head coach, Andy Reid, expressed his amazement at Mahomes’ rapid recovery, highlighting the quarterback’s mental fortitude and unwavering determination. Reid’s comments reflected a sense of awe and admiration for Mahomes’ ability to consistently overcome injuries and perform at an elite level. Mahomes himself, while acknowledging the uncertainty surrounding his availability earlier in the week, ultimately delivered a performance that exceeded expectations. His determination to avoid limiting the team’s game plan, even with the injury, showcased his dedication to winning and his refusal to compromise the team’s potential.

This latest instance of Mahomes playing through injury was not an isolated incident. In the 2022 playoffs, he returned to the field after suffering an ankle sprain in the AFC Championship game against the Cincinnati Bengals, leading the Chiefs to a thrilling victory. He then went on to play in the Super Bowl two weeks later, guiding the team to another championship. These experiences demonstrated Mahomes’ ability to perform at the highest level even when not fully healthy, solidifying his reputation as a clutch player who thrives under pressure.

The Chiefs’ victory over the Texans extended their remarkable streak of 16 consecutive one-possession wins, surpassing the previous record held by the 2004 New England Patriots. This achievement highlighted the team’s ability to perform in close games and secure victories even when facing adversity. More importantly, the win placed the Chiefs just one victory away from securing the No. 1 seed in the AFC, which would guarantee them a first-round bye and home-field advantage throughout the playoffs. This strategic advantage would be crucial in their quest to become the first team in NFL history to win three consecutive Super Bowls.

Mahomes’ ability to return from injury quickly and perform effectively has been a recurring theme throughout his career. The last time he missed a game due to injury was in 2019, when he sat out two games after dislocating his patella. His rapid recovery and return to form have become a testament to his exceptional physical and mental resilience. The Chiefs’ pursuit of a historic third consecutive Super Bowl title rests heavily on Mahomes’ continued health and performance. His latest heroics against the Texans, achieved despite a significant ankle injury, have not only bolstered the team’s chances of achieving this remarkable feat but have also reinforced Mahomes’ status as one of the most resilient and determined quarterbacks in the NFL. His willingness to play through pain, his commitment to his team, and his unwavering focus on victory make him a truly exceptional leader and a driving force behind the Chiefs’ pursuit of greatness.
